WebA synovial fluid analysis is a group of tests that checks for disorders that affect the joints. The tests usually include the following: An exam of physical qualities of the fluid, such as its color and thickness. Chemical tests to check for changes in the fluid's chemicals. Microscopic analysis to look for crystals, bacteria, and other substances. WebSep 27, 2024 · The only pathognomonic laboratory tests for rheumatic disease are the identification of synovial fluid crystals in gout or pseudogout or a positive culture in septic arthritis. Screening blood tests should be discouraged other than an ESR or CRP that may help to assess whether an inflammatory, systemic disease is present.

WebOct 7, 2024 · In combination with a negative Gram stain and bacterial cultures, a diagnosis of gout or pseudogout may be established by confirming the presence of crystals of monosodium urate (MSU) or calcium pyrophosphate dihydrate (CPPD) in a patient presenting with unexplained inflammatory arthritis.

WebThis condition results from the abnormal formation of calcium pyrophosphate dihydrate (CPPD) crystals in the cartilage (cartilage is the "cushion" between the bones) or the joint fluid (synovial fluid). This can lead to a sudden attack of arthritis similar to gout. The cause of abnormal deposits of CPPD crystals in cartilage is often unknown.
